I am fed up with PCT position...
Being a PCA in a hospital setting is for the thick-skinned (IMO). Once you get on your unit, get report from the other aid and begin your vitals and finger sticks because once the Nurses are done getting report frist thing their going to need is that information. Distractions may come in the way like a call light, a patient needing assistance, discharging a patient out at the last minute for the pervious shift, transporting a patient, picking up the slack from the previous shift, a code, and etc., all while taking vitals. I had my moments and their where a few times where I told a few of them to step outside because I didn't want to be disrespected or disrespectful in front of the patients and/or staffs...There are some that may try to test you, but you have to stand firm and abrasive against the storm. There are the Nurses who really don't try to be mean or rude, its just the pressure that their under. Give your best 12 hours and leave it there at the end of your shift.
